AMD's Ryzen X3D processors are considered to be among the best gaming processors on the market, with performance close to or far superior to flagship CPUs in most online games, but neither generation of X3D processors supports official overclocking.

Wccftech reports that the AMD Ryzen 9000X3D CPU offers full overclocking support, which is also the first time that AMD Ryzen X3D chips have supported official overclocking.

AMD initially took a very conservative approach with the Ryzen 5000X3D processor, with strict temperature and voltage restrictions, and no official tuning options.

Later, AMD introduced the Zen 4-based Ryzen 7000 Series X3D processors with 2nd Gen 3D V-Cache technology, providing enthusiasts with more tuning options, including Precision Boost Overdrive (PBO) and Curve Optimizer (CO) features, as well as EXPO memory overclocking, which was highly sought after by gamers.

The next generation of Zen 5-based Ryzen 9000X3D processors will have more exciting geek features and full support for overclocking settings, and gamers on the AM5 platform will be able to enjoy full overclocking support on the new generation of X3D processors.

According to Wccftech, AMD Ryzen 9000 series CPUs are cooler and consume less power, DDR5 overclocking performance is greatly enhanced, and gamers will still be able to use their previous DDR5-6000 memory, albeit with a maximum memory frequency of 6400 MT/s while maintaining a 1:1 FCLK to MCLK ratio.

It is claimed that the processors will also support up to 8000 MT/s of EXPO memory in 4-DIMM mode at a 1:2 ratio. In addition, there are already motherboard manufacturers developing 9000 MT/s or even 10000 MT/s memory support, more details can be seen in the previous report of IT Home.
